WebJan 22, 2024 · Mike Archer, 1987 (10-1-1) Bill Arnsparger, 1983 (8-3-1) Jerry Stovall, 1980 (7-4) Charles McClendon, 1962 (9-1-1) The LSU Tigers football team represents Louisiana State University in the sport of American football. The university has fielded a team every year since it began play in 1893, except in 1918 due to World War I. It has competed in the Southeastern Conference (SEC) since 1933, and in the conference's Western division since 1992. WebNov 28, 2024 · I tried to find (via google and bing) the final base salary of each of the coaches, but some of the figures may include perks. Paul Dietzel (not inclucing AD salary) - $18.5k. Charles McClendon - $31.5k. Bo Rein - $50k. Jerry Stovall - $42k. Bill Arnsparger - $80k. Mike Archer - $88.4k. Curley Hallman - $90k. Gerry Dinardo - $95k.
